Sarina Wiegman wants Mary Earps to get a fitting Lionesses send-off at Wembley

  • England manager Sarina Wiegman hopes Mary Earps receives a deserved send-off before the World Cup qualifier against Spain at Wembley.
  • Earps retired from international duty ahead of Euro 2025, having been a key player in the Lionesses' Euro 2022 victory and 2023 World Cup final run.
  • Her autobiography, All In, published last November, caused controversy due to comments criticising Hannah Hampton's inclusion in the Lionesses squad.
  • Earps later expressed regret over the comments in her book, stating she had "learned some tough lessons" from the fallout.
  • Wiegman has put the incident behind her, emphasising Earps' inspirational role and hoping for a celebratory reception for the former world's best goalkeeper.
